PB课程设计—网上考试系统

PB课程设计—网上考试系统

ID:43709446

大小:1.38 MB

页数:20页

时间:2019-10-13

PB课程设计—网上考试系统_第1页
PB课程设计—网上考试系统_第2页
PB课程设计—网上考试系统_第3页
PB课程设计—网上考试系统_第4页
PB课程设计—网上考试系统_第5页
资源描述:

《PB课程设计—网上考试系统》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、网上盪裸系铳一、本组设计的功能描述功能说明如下:1.登录:管理员、教师、学生分不同页面2.考生的录入删除3.试卷录入4.查询学生成绩的信息(1)学号查询(2)姓名查询5.导出数据到各种格式中,另存标准答案6.学生答题与提交7.学生成绩录入8.老师对学生答案的研究与评分9.标准答案查询10.教师菜单(1)试卷录入(2)成绩录入(3)试卷查询(4)标准答案查询11•帮助——对程序功能的说明二、本组设计的主要特色口前随着校园网的健全与普及为在各个学校内举行无纸化的网上考试系统的建立提供了必要的条件。网上无纸化考试系统可以充分的发挥考试题库的作用,方便管理员对试题库的综合管理:方便教师及时、

2、全而、均衡的组织试卷、批阅试卷以及分析考生考试的具体情况,方便考生参加考试和杳阅分数,省去了试卷的打印、印刷、装订和批阅等一系列过程,大大的减轻了教师的工作量并可以避免在出卷印刷装订等过程屮的不安全性,并且可以灵活的安排考试吋间,方便了管理部门及参加考试的学生,对于客观题可以自动阅卷,客观题的考试成绩在考试后就能够立即输出,并自动送到数据服务器的成绩数据表中,增强了阅卷的公正性以及成绩的准确性,可以随时产生相应的成绩统计等。随着技术的进一步的发展与完善,网上无纸化考试系统正在成为网上教学系统和网络办公系统的不可或缺的重要组成部分,成为大多数科口组织考试的一种手段。我做的程序:1.考试

3、试卷应该是随机的,即不同学科考住的试卷是不同的,但是总体的试卷难度应该是均等的;2.每位考生每个课程只能考一次,并口考试需耍得到老师的授权,否则不得考试;3.考试结果必须严格保存,以便学生教师等再次查询,并防止泄密;4.系统应该站在学生的角度,考虑学生考试时候的心情,充分做到简单操作,较少不必要的因为紧张造成的误操作。三、系统分析与设计•系统总体设计一一确定程序功能模块;•系统详细设计一一在总体设计基础上设计系统总体框架、数据结构(类)、关键算法的流程;•最后编制源程序。1.系统功能模块划分及说明2.总体框架,数据文件等3.系统关键算法流程图4.源程序关键性代码本系统以三种角色进入即

4、管理员、老师、学生。管理员各参与系统的各个功能实现,例如学生信息的录入删除,成绩查询,试卷答案查询,试卷查询但是不能改动学生试卷。也可以进行系统维护,还有帮助来解释程序功能。老师登陆时,有试卷录入,成绩录入,还可以查询学生作答情况、学生评分等功能,可以在—菜单中实现。学生登陆时只可以答题、查询成绩、查询标准答案。程序中有帮助一项具体说明。一、各张表的逻辑结构如下:列名数据类型长度是否为空姓名char100密码char100表一管理员表的逻辑结构列名数据类型长度是否为空7号char100姓名char101性别char100密码char100考试科冃char100考试标记int41表二学

5、生表逻辑结构列名数据类型长度是否为空教师姓名char100密码char100表三教师表逻辑结构列名数据类型长度是否为空学科char101题号int41题目内容char501选项Achar501选项Bchar501选项Cchar501答案int41表四试卷表逻辑结构列名数据类型长度是否为空学科char101题号int41题FI内容char501答案int41备注char501表五试题答案表逻辑结构列名数据类型长度是否为空学科char501学号char101题1int41题2int41题3int41题4int41题5int41得分int41表六学生作答表逻辑结构由于对框架的完善,加入了员

6、工培训的内容。二、数据库关系图该关系图体现了数据库中表的格局与内容。但是另外的课程信息表并没有涉及,而是另外的两个表。三、各部分功能简要说明1、w_denglu登录窗口”确定“按钮代码stringllpasswordjlusemamell_username=trim(sle_l.text)ll_password=trim(slc_2.tcxt)ifrb_l.checked=truethenSELECT管理员表.name,管理员表.passwordINTO:ll_uscmamc,:ll_passwordFROM管理员表WHERE管理员表.name=:ll_usernameand管理员表

7、.password=:ll_password;ifsqlca.sqlcode=0thenopcn(w_guanli)elsemessagebox(u错误!”,”用户名或密码不正确!n,exclamation!,ok!,2)endif//elseendififrb_2.checked=truethenSELECT教师表.name,教师表.passwordINTO:ll_username,:ll_passwordFROM教师表WHERE教师表.name=:ll

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。